"Fermi Manga University"
This is a channel where the protagonist,
"Rin Mochizuki," explains self-improvement books
in an easy-to-understand
story format.
The way she cuts straight to the point for troubled people
and offers answers like "do this"
is truly convincing to watch.
The refreshing feeling you get
after watching is also great 🎵

Piyo Piyo Sokuho
This is an explanatory channel that
uses historical figures from the past
to offer advice on various worries and actions.
Because the historical figures
bluntly state their solutions, it is incredibly persuasive.
It also addresses universal human struggles,
so it is great that it appeals to everyone as well.

Gakushiki Salon
This is a YouTube channel where you can learn self-improvement
even if you are short on time,
as it proceeds concisely using PowerPoint-style explanations.
Just as the expression "scratches the itch" suggests, "Gakushiki Salon" is a channel that teaches you exactly the parts you want to know.
It explains things in a logical progression, so a recommended point is that you can understand it without getting confused.
